BPgorilla Posted April 12, 2013 Share Posted April 12, 2013 Can someone please tell me if Parlon can be substituted for PVC, & y?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
BlastFromThePast Posted April 12, 2013 Share Posted April 12, 2013 You can, but for a given formula asking for parlon, you might not get the same effect using PVC. Also, Parlon is a higher %age Cl donor than PVC is, however using chlorate over perchlorate can make up for the PVC being less.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
